
Explore the Exciting Okada Manila Slot Machine Experience: Win Big with Premium Games
Explore the Exciting Okada Manila Slot Machine Experience: Win Big with Premium GamesIf you’re looking to experience the best in casino gaming, look no further than Okada Manila, one of the premier luxury resorts and casinos in the Philippines. Among the many attractions at this opulent destination, the Okada Manila sl...